Dear Tiger Familes,
It is very important to note that the 3rd-5th grade students have very important online testing next week. You will hear it referred to as "Interim" or "DA2" testing. These tests are to gather information about what we need to focus on next semester before your student is required to take the STAAR state assessments. With the exception of the 4th-grade Writing test, the assessments will cover content they HAVE covered AND content they HAVE NOT covered yet. Again, this helps us know how to best support student learning to be sure they have mastered all objectives in the Texas Essential Knowledge and Skills for their grade level before the end of the school year.
It is imperative each student does his or her own work on this test and is encouraged to do their personal best. After the testing window is completed, we will analyze the data, set goals with students, and arrange supportive plans to help them reach their goals. As their parent, YOU will be an important part of their support team to be successful.
Thank you so much for all you do to work with your student and their teachers.
Together, we can make a difference for the kids!

Household Income Verification Form
Harmony Public Schools is required to collect and report the socioeconomic status of each student to the Texas Education Agency for purposes of the annual state accountability ratings and for federal reporting. The data collected is also used by educational agencies to determine funding which may be used for various enrichment and additional services. If you have not already received a notice stating that your child qualifies for free or reduced-price meals, please complete the “CONFIDENTIAL Household” form in Skyward. Upon login to Skyward, this form is accessible from the main screen. If you have any questions, please contact the Business Manager for HSI Euless, Araceli Ortiz, araceli.ortiz@harmonytx.org.

FALL READING CHALLENGE
Reading is a passion we want students to continue to love as they move into their adult lives. A love of reading is one of the best gifts we can impart to our students. Guiding and modeling for students to read more and discover more about who they are as readers this is what a challenge is all about.
So, what’s the challenge?
For this challenge at Harmony in grades Kindergarten to 5th grade, we are going to start with the fall semester. For the fall, we are asking every KIndergarten, 1st, and 2nd grader to read at least 20 books; and every 3rd, 4th, and 5th-grader to challenge themselves to read at least 10 novels.
It is not a grade but an opportunity to share and enjoy reading; teachers should make this a part of their class with regular updates on progress, celebrations of achievements, and book chats on what everyone is reading.
